In this comparison, we are comparing a tyre from a manufacturer from USA (BFGoodrich) against a tyre from a manufacturer from Japan (Yokohama). BFGoodrich is a brand that belongs to the Michelin group. Generally, BFGoodrich winter tyres are slightly better rated (75%) than Yokohama (46%). The first tyre test of BFGoodrich G-FORCE WINTER 2 was done in 2017, compared to 2018 when was the Yokohama BluEarth winter V905 first tested. When it comes to comparison, eu labels can be also interesting - 100% of BFGoodrich G-FORCE WINTER 2 has B wet grip rating, whereas 78% of Yokohama BluEarth winter V905 has C rating. We also know where G-FORCE WINTER 2 is made - Romania/Poland.
